Summerville, Sc vs Surgut Climate & Distance Between

Russia flag
  • The distance between Summerville, Sc, Usa and Surgut, Russia is approximately 9,265 km or 5,758 mi.
  • To reach Summerville, Sc in this distance one would set out from Surgut bearing 338°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Summerville, Sc bearing 192.4° or SSW .
  • Summerville, Sc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Surgut has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• Summerville, Sc is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Surgut is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 20.7 °C (37.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.5 °C (35.1°F) less in Summerville, Sc.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 835.8 mm (32.9 in) more which is equivalent to 835.8 l/m² (20.51 US gal/ft²) or 8,358,000 l/ha (893,526 US gal/ac) more. About 2 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.2° higher in Summerville, Sc than in Surgut.
